There are 2 benchmark scripts bench and bench-std-json. They are very similar. Their engines each have 4 rpc methods and randomly choose an input json from common 'test_cases_2'.
The following output can be reproduced by running bench.sh.

Below simdjzon-rpc to std-json-rpc with these options
build mode | allocator |
---|---|
ReleaseFast, ReleaseSafe | Gpa, C allocator |
These benchmarks happen at the end of scripts/bench.sh.
TLDR: simdjzon-rpc is between 6%-27% faster in 3/4 cases and 5.5% slower with the ReleaseSafe/Gpa combo. simdjzon-rpc runs 27% faster with a ReleaseFast, C Allocator combo.
